Earnings Numbers

For the quarter ended on July 29, 2016, Medtronic reported earnings of $929 million, or $0.66 per share, higher by 13% as compared to earnings of $820 million, or $0.57 per share in the prior year's quarter. Adjustments in the quarter primarily included certain litigation as well as restructuring charges, intangible asset amortization, acquisition-related items and certain tax adjustments. Excluding items, the company earned $1.03 a share compared to $1.02 a year ago. Analysts expected earnings of $1.01 a share. Medtronic's bottom-line was helped by a lower income-tax provision and effective tax rate in the quarter, while its net interest expense dropped 6.2%.

Revenue declined 1.5% to $7.17 billion, in-line with analysts' expectation. The company blamed the decline on an extra week included in the prior-year period and the impact of foreign currency fluctuation which took $7 million out of the quarterly revenue. The company noted that revenue improved 5%, excluding the extra week and currency effects.

During Q1 FY17, total costs of products sold declined approximately 8%, while provision for income taxes more than halved to $59 million from $120 million in the year ago period.

"Q1 was another strong quarter for Medtronic, where our diversified businesses and geographies delivered solid results," said Omar Ishrak, Medtronic's chairman and chief executive officer.

Segment Results

During Q1 FY17, revenue from Medtronic's cardiac and vascular unit, which sells defibrillators, pace-makers, heart valves and stents, dropped 2.1% to $2.52 billion; however revenue increased by mid-single digits on an adjusted basis. The division accounted for about 35% of total sales in the reported quarter. The company's minimally-invasive therapies group, formerly the Covidien Group, which includes patient monitoring and surgical devices, declined 1% to $2.42 billion or a mid-single digit increase on an adjusted basis.

Medtronic's restorative therapies unit, which consists of the Spine, Neuromodulation, Surgical Technologies and Neurovascular segments, saw a revenue drop of 2% to $1.77 billion. The diabetes care unit, which comprise of the Diabetes Group, including the Intensive Insulin Management, Non-Intensive Diabetes Therapies and Diabetes Services & Solutions divisions, saw revenue grow by 2% to $452 million.

Heartware Acquisition

Medical equipment manufacturers are operating in a hyper competitive market, facing tough negotiation from hospitals that have grown in size and driving a hard bargain on the price. In order to counter the margin pressures and increase their negotiating leverage and pricing power, these manufacturers are trying to strengthen their offering through acquisition.

On April 28, 2016, Abbott Laboratories announced a deal to acquire St. Jude Medical Inc. in a $25 billion tie up. On June 27, 2016, Medtronic revealed that it would purchase HeartWare International Inc. for $1.1 billion. The company closed the deal with HeartWare on August 23, 2016, with each outstanding share of HeartWare converted into the right to receive $58 in cash. Medtronic intends to offset any dilutive impact of the deal for two years, until the deal turns profitable in the third year.

Guidance

Medtronic reaffirmed its forecast for FY 2017 adjusted earnings in the range of $4.60 per share to $4.70 per share. For Q2 FY17, the company revenue is projected to grow 5% to 6%, and earnings per share are expected to finish in the lower half of a range of 12% to 16% growth.
